2025 Estate and Gift Tax Exclusions

Estate Tax Exclusion

 Estates of decedents who die during 2025 have a basic exclusion amount of $13,990,000, increased from $13,610,000 for estates of decedents who died in 2024.

In 2026 After Trump's Tax Reform expire, this exclusion will be about half of that (projected to be close to $7 million). So you potentially can lose a $7 million exclusion costing $2.8 million in additional estate taxes if estate planning for gifts is not done by the end of 2025.

Annual Exclusion for Gifts increases to $19,000 for calendar year 2025, rising from $18,000 for calendar year 2024.
